MS Fatigue and tDCS on Fatigue in Multiple Sclerosis
MS Fatigue and tDCS on Fatigue in Multiple Sclerosis

NCT05890885

CompletedNA

Sponsor: Assistance Publique - Hôpitaux de Paris

Conditions: Fatigue in Multiple Sclerosis

Interventions: Real left prefrontal tDCS - sham, Sham - Real left prefrontal tDCS

Countries: France

The available therapeutic strategies for Multiple Sclerosis (MS)-related symptoms are usually faced with limited efficacy and numerous side effects. Patients with MS frequently suffer from fatigue, affective symptoms, and cognitive deficits.

Eligibility criteria
Inclusion Criteria:

* Definite MS diagnosis according to the 2017 McDonald criteria
* Fatigue since more than 6 months as assessed by fatigue severity scale (FSS\>5)
* Age between 18 and 75 years.
* Stable pharmacological and physical treatment since at least one month
* Affiliation to the social security regimen
* Signature of the informed consent
* Ability of the patient to understand the instructions for use of the pacemaker to ensure safe use

Exclusion Criteria:

* Relapses within the last two months
* Active medical device implanted
* Intracranial metal implants
* Craniotomy, cranial trepanation, aneurysm
* Uncontrolled epilepsy
* Non-weaned alcoholism, sleep debt
* Expanded disability status scale ≥ 6.5
* Severe depression based on Beck Depression inventory (BDI\>19)
* Daytime sleepiness based on Epworth Sleepiness Scale (ESS\> 11)
* Other neurologic and psychiatric diseases
* Known pregnancy by the investigator or breastfeeding
* Physical or mental incapacity to give informed consent
* Participation in another study (exclusion period following a previous study should be ≥ 6 months)
* Patients on AME
* Patients under legal protection
* Prisoners
